  • Patent number: 10844133
    Abstract: The invention relates to the treatment and/or prevention of tumor diseases associated with cells expressing CLDN6, in particular cancer and cancer metastasis using antibodies which bind to CLDN6. The present application demonstrates that the binding of antibodies to CLDN6 on the surface of tumor cells is sufficient to inhibit growth of the tumor and to prolong survival and extend the lifespan of tumor patients. Furthermore, binding of antibodies to CLDN6 is efficient in inhibiting growth of CLDN6 positive germ cell tumors such as teratocarcinomas or embryonal carcinomas, in particular germ cell tumors of the testis.

  • Patent number: 10137195
    Abstract: The present invention generally provides a therapy for effectively treating and/or preventing diseases associated with cells expressing CLDN18.2, in particular cancer diseases such as gastroesophageal cancer. Data are presented demonstrating that administration of an anti-CLDN18.2 antibody to human patients with gastroesophageal cancer is safe and well-tolerated up to a dose of at least 1000 mg/m2. Furthermore, data are presented demonstrating that the antibody is fully functional in these patients to execute anti-tumor cell effects and evidence for antitumoral activity was obtained.
